storage - more telemetry (integrity check, more times)

This commit is contained in:
Benjamin Pasero
2018-10-17 10:46:03 +02:00
parent 83cfe7dd09
commit 88550a6fbb
5 changed files with 97 additions and 23 deletions
@@ -53,9 +53,16 @@ bootstrapWindow.load([
function showPartsSplash(configuration) {
perf.mark('willShowPartsSplash');
// TODO@Ben remove me after a while
perf.mark('willAccessLocalStorage');
let storage = window.localStorage;
perf.mark('didAccessLocalStorage');
let data;
try {
let raw = window.localStorage.getItem('storage://global/parts-splash-data');
perf.mark('willReadLocalStorage');
let raw = storage.getItem('storage://global/parts-splash-data');
perf.mark('didReadLocalStorage');
data = JSON.parse(raw);
} catch (e) {
// ignore